The second series of Celebrity Race Across The World will see contestants (a celeb and a plus one) dropped in Belém, Northern Brazil – the gateway to the Amazon. Five checkpoints across the length of South America later they are expected to cross the finish line in Frutillar in Southern Chile. That's the Andes by the way. Will they all make it?

This year the celebs are model and actress Kelly Brook with husband Jeremy Parisi, BBC Radio 2’s Scott Mills with husband (fiancé during filming) Sam Vaughan, TV Presenter Jeff Brazier with son Freddie and Ted Lasso star Kola Bokinni with cousin Mary Ellen. How to watch Celebrity Race Across The World season 2 online in the UK for free

BBC One Wednesday, August 14  9 pm BST

Celebrity Race Across The World season 2 premieres on BBC One on Wednesday, August 14 at 9 pm BST. And then every Wednesday at the same time subsequently.

The show will also be available on BBC iPlayer the same day.

BBC One and iPlayer are free to watch for license fee payers. If you're trying to access iPlayer while traveling outside the UK, you might want to use a VPN to allow you to watch iPlayer from anywhere.
